You are given the sample mean and the population standard deviation. Use this information to construct the 90% and 95% confidence intervals for the population mean. Interpret the results and compare the widths of the confidence intervals. From a random sample of 79 dates, the mean record high daily temperature in a certain city has a mean of 85.60°F. Assume the population standard deviation is 14.98°F. The 90% confidence interval is (). (Round to two decimal places as needed.)
